How to Scan an iNews TV QR Code
Okay, so you're ready to start scanning. Awesome! Here's the lowdown on how to do it:
- Grab Your Smartphone or Tablet: This is your weapon of choice.
 - Open Your Camera App: Most smartphones these days have a built-in QR code scanner in their camera app. Just open the app like you're going to take a photo.
 - Point and Focus: Aim your camera at the QR code. Make sure the entire code is visible in the viewfinder and that it's in focus.
 - Wait for the Magic: Your phone should automatically recognize the QR code. You'll usually see a notification or a link pop up.
 - Tap the Link: Tap the notification or link, and your phone will take you directly to the iNews TV live broadcast or the relevant content.
 
Pro-Tip: If your camera app doesn't automatically scan QR codes, don't panic! There are tons of free QR code scanner apps available in the App Store or Google Play Store. Just download one, and you'll be good to go.
Troubleshooting Scanning Issues
Sometimes, things don't go as smoothly as planned. If you're having trouble scanning the QR code, here are a few things to try:
- Make Sure There's Enough Light: QR codes need good lighting to be scanned properly. If you're in a dimly lit area, try moving to a brighter spot.
 - Clean Your Camera Lens: A smudged or dirty camera lens can make it difficult for your phone to focus on the QR code. Give it a quick wipe with a clean cloth.
 - Get Closer or Further Away: Sometimes, you might be too close or too far away from the QR code. Try adjusting the distance to see if that helps.
 - Ensure the Code Isn't Distorted: If the QR code is printed on a curved surface or is otherwise distorted, it can be difficult to scan. Try to find a flat, undistorted version of the code.
 - Restart Your Phone: When all else fails, try restarting your phone. This can sometimes fix minor software glitches that might be interfering with the scanning process.
